Barcelona Airport Transfer to Sagrada Família: Your Complete Guide

Overview

Traveling from Barcelona El Prat Airport (BCN) to the iconic Sagrada Família spans approximately 15 km, with a typical journey time of 20–40 minutes depending on traffic. This guide covers everything from budget-friendly public transport to premium private transfers, ensuring you start your Gaudí-inspired adventure smoothly.

Getting to Know Sagrada Família

Antoni Gaudí’s unfinished masterpiece, the Basílica de la Sagrada Família, is a UNESCO World Heritage Site and Barcelona’s most visited attraction. Its surrealist spires and intricate facades blend Gothic and Art Nouveau styles, drawing over 4 million visitors annually. Located in the Eixample district, the basilica is surrounded by metro stations, cafés, and Gaudí’s other works like Casa Batlló and Park Güell.

Arriving at Barcelona El Prat Airport

Barcelona’s main international airport has two terminals: T1 (long-haul flights) and T2 (low-cost carriers). Both offer clear signage in English, Spanish, and Catalan. After baggage claim, head to the ground transportation area, where taxis, buses, and private transfer pickups are organized. Consider exchanging currency or purchasing a local SIM card at airport kiosks for connectivity.

Main Transfer Options

Public Transport: Metro and Bus

  • Aerobús: Direct buses (€6.75) run every 10 minutes from T1 and T2 to Plaça Catalunya, connecting to Sagrada Família via Metro L2/L5 (15-minute ride). Total travel time: ~50 minutes.
  • Metro L9 Sud: Connects both terminals to Collblanc station (€5.15), then transfer to L5. Budget-friendly but involves multiple changes.

Taxi & Rideshare

  • Official Taxis: Fixed fare of €35–€40 to Sagrada Família (includes luggage fees). Avoid unlicensed cabs.
  • Rideshares: Apps like Cabify or Bolt cost €25–€35. Confirm pickup zones in advance.

Car Rentals

Major providers like Sixt and Europcar operate at both terminals. Note: Parking near Sagrada Família is limited and expensive.

Travel Tips & Local Insights

  • Avoid Rush Hour: Weekdays 8–10 AM and 6–8 PM add 15+ minutes to road transfers.
  • Pre-Book Sagrada Tickets: Timed entry slots sell out days in advance on official website.
  • Luggage Note: Public transport restricts large suitcases during peak hours.
  • Scenic Detour: Ask drivers to pass by Arc de Triomf for a quick photo op.

Reaching Your Final Destination

Most transfers drop passengers at Carrer de Mallorca, the basilica’s main entrance. From taxi stands, it’s a 2-minute walk. If arriving via metro (Sagrada Família L2/L5 station), follow signs to the Nativity Façade.
